Unpacking the Dangers of E-Waste
Our increasingly digital world comes with a hidden cost: e-waste. These discarded electronic devices, from laptops, to copiers, are littering landfills worldwide. Sadly, e-waste is more than just junk; it's a ticking time bomb of hazardous materials. Heavy metals like lead, mercury, and cadmium escape from these devices, contaminating the soil and water supply. This poses a serious threat to human health and the environment.
- E-waste harbors harmful substances that can destroy our environment.
- Unsafe disposal of e-waste releases these toxins into the air, water, and soil.
- The manufacturing of new electronic devices often involves extracting rare earth metals, which can have harmful impacts on local communities and ecosystems.
We must to take measures to minimize e-waste. This includes repairing our electronics, encouraging sustainable manufacturing, and raising awareness the public about the dangers of e-waste.
